Typical tasks include: dimensioning of piles, sheet piles, slopes, bearing capacity, soil nailing, jet grouting, KC-piles, lightweight fill, and especially active design where we need to adapt to reality and production needs. ABOUT THE POSITION DEKRA is the leading company in Sweden in the field of pressure equipment and is now seeking staff members for our offices in Gävle and Borlänge! As an inspection engineer, you will work with inspection and testing of pressure equipment such as boilers, pressure vessels, cisterns, pipelines, and cooling systems. You will ensure that equipment meets applicable legal requirements and regulations, and contribute to our customers maintaining a high safety level in their operations. The work involves both recurring inspections and testing in a wide range of environments, from industrial and energy facilities to properties, hospitals, and large kitchens. Work with pressure equipment offers great variety, technical challenges, and many customer interactions! We work according to the principle of freedom under responsibility, which means you independently plan and structure your working days. One day can start with inspection of a cooking kettle in a school kitchen and end with testing safety functions on a steam boiler in a power station – the breadth of assignments makes the role both developmental and varied. Our Operations The Rheumatology Section at Akademiska sjukhuset in Uppsala is offering two physician positions in rheumatology. Our operations include a large outpatient clinic with approximately 10,000 physician visits per year, a day care unit for infusion treatments and outpatient investigations, as well as inpatient care. Rheumatology has 7 inpatient beds for investigation and treatment of systemic diseases. We are a cohesive group of physicians who discuss difficult cases together during rounds where the entire team participates. We also have good collaboration including regular rounds with other specialties, such as pulmonology, which is stimulating and contributes to better patient care. National and regional care accounts for approximately 30% of inpatient care, which means important and stimulating contact with colleagues in our region. Active research is conducted in several different projects and we participate in a number of clinical drug trials. Currently we have 12 specialists and 8 specialty residents in the department. Rheumatology is well integrated within the hospital. We are responsible for rheumatology education in term 6 of the medical program.
